The video tutorial explains how to evaluate expressions using rational exponents. It begins by introducing the concept of rewriting cube roots as rational exponents. The tutorial then demonstrates how to apply properties of exponents to simplify expressions, including handling negative exponents by using reciprocals. The process of evaluating expressions with rational exponents is illustrated, showing how to rewrite bases and calculate the result. The tutorial concludes with a summary of the steps involved in simplifying expressions using rational exponents.
